Name Released in Single Vehicle Accident

Authorities have identified the pedestrian killed early Monday in Itasca County as a 14-year-old girl.

According to the State Patrol, Dakota K. Jones and a 13-year-old girl were walking in the southbound lane of Highway 169 when they were struck by a 2002 Chevrolet Monte Carlo driven by 18 year old Matthew Dean Tombeck, of Marble, Minnesota. 

The collision occurred around 1:25 a.m. near Coleraine. Jones was pronounced dead at the scene. The 13-year-old victim was airlifted to St. Mary’s Medical Center in Duluth with what troopers at the scene described as non-life-threatening injuries. 

No details have been released by authorities as to where the girls were heading when they were struck.

Officials say the driver had not been consuming alcohol prior to the accident. The driver and a passenger in the vehicle suffered no apparent injury.
